We're listening to the Fan 960 online for post-game reaction, listening to the people calling in when all of a sudden - BREAKING NEWS! The host goes on to inform listeners that the Flames have traded Andrew Ference and Chuck Kobasew to Boston for Brad Stuart, Wayne Primeau and a draft pick. My emotional reaction to this news shocked me - my stomach dropped, my heart hurt and my eyes teared up. Kobasew, fine, he's your average hockey player but Andy? Oh no...
Here is a guy who signed a 3 year contract earlier this year for less than he's worth so he could stay playing in Calgary. Here is a guy who gives back to the community immensely through his work with Right to Play. Here is a guy who plays with heart, who is defeated when the Flames lose. The other night after the Flames lost, he had a post-game interview and you could tell he felt horrible because it was his penalty he took late in the game that led to the loss.
The people on the radio and on the message boards are busy talking about whether or not the Flames picked up rentals in Stuart and Primeau, whether or not Sutter can sign Stuart (Primeau not so much) who is an UFA next year.
What gets me is how this trade went down - the team was sitting on the bus, waiting to go to the airport, waiting, waiting, waiting when assistant coach Rich Preston comes on, takes Andy off the bus to tell him the news.
